  • War Hawk | History, Significance, Facts | Britannica
    War Hawk, in U S history, any of the expansionists primarily composed of young Southerners and Westerners elected to the U S Congress in 1810, whose territorial ambitions in the Northwest and Florida inspired them to agitate for war with Great Britain
  • WAR HAWK Definition Meaning | Dictionary. com
    (initial capital letters) any of the congressmen from the South and West, led by Henry Clay and John Calhoun, who wanted war against Britain in the period leading up to the War of 1812
